Understanding Mooring Rights and Berths
For boating enthusiasts, the opportunity to keep a vessel close to home is one of the Marina's most compelling features. That said, mooring rights are not automatically included with every apartment, and this is a detail worth investigating carefully before purchase.
Buyers should confirm whether a berth is included in the sale, understand the size specifications and whether the arrangement is freehold or leased, and factor in any associated community costs. Where a berth is included, it adds meaningfully to both the lifestyle value and the long-term resale appeal of the property.

Marina Living vs Other Areas of Sotogrande
Each part of Sotogrande has its own distinct character, and the right choice depends entirely on what a buyer is looking for.
- The Marina suits those who want waterfront living, easy access to amenities and the option to keep a boat nearby. It appeals particularly to buyers seeking a property that works well as both a lifestyle asset and a rental investment.
- Sotogrande Costa offers closer proximity to the beach and a more established residential feel, with a strong mix of family homes and a well-rooted community.
- Sotogrande Alto is the natural choice for golf enthusiasts and those seeking larger plots, elevated views and a quieter, more rural atmosphere.
